Abstract
This utility model relates to a kind of Quick Response Code position detecting device for rotor spinning machine accessory cart, including accessory cart and guide rail, accessory cart is walked on guide rail, Quick Response Code code reader is installed on accessory cart, being provided with Quick Response Code bar code strip on guide rail, Quick Response Code code reader reads the information of Quick Response Code bar code strip.The Quick Response Code code reader that this utility model is fixed on accessory cart by employing detects the Quick Response Code bar code strip information on guide rail, determines the coordinate distance of accessory cart, is calculated the accessory cart ingot position in stage casing, provides the foundation for improving product quality.

Background technology
Rotor spinning is one of open-end-spinning method, claims rotor spinning because using revolving cup cohesion ultimate fibre.The spinning speed of rotor spinning is high, and winding capacity is big, spins rudimentary cotton and useless noil has good spin ability, and work situation is also greatly improved.Critical piece used by rotor spinning has revolving cup, cotton feeder structure, combing roller, doffing tube and resistance to pick up device etc., package unit is referred to as spinning organ, ingot between each spindle of spinning organ away from being fixing, the accessory cart of rotor spinning machine in running it needs to be determined that whether dolly in the position, ingot position needed.At present, do not have set of device can be accurately positioned the position, ingot position of accessory cart, have impact on the raising of product quality.It is therefore proposed that this utility model.

Detailed description of the invention
Below in conjunction with specific embodiment, this utility model is further described, but protection domain of the present utility model is not limited to this.
As shown in Figure 1, this utility model is for the Quick Response Code position detecting device of rotor spinning machine accessory cart, including accessory cart 1 and guide rail 2, accessory cart 1 walks back and forth on guide rail 2, Quick Response Code code reader 3 it is installed with on accessory cart 1, being pasted with Quick Response Code bar code strip on guide rail 2, Quick Response Code bar code strip includes the positional information of coordinate axes.
By the coordinate information of the Quick Response Code bar code strip on Quick Response Code code reader 3 Scanning Detction guide rail 2 in accessory cart 1 running, obtain the coordinate axes information of accessory cart 1, thus the ingot position positional information going out accessory cart 1 place calculated, use very convenient, and lay a good foundation for improving product quality.
